Comparison Overview

The most significant difference between the 2025 Audi SQ5 Sportback (Car 1) and the 2025 Lincoln Aviator (Car 2) lies in output, with the Aviator generating 400 hp and 415 lb-ft of torque compared to the SQ5 Sportback's 349 hp and 369 lb-ft of torque, a deficit of 51 hp for the Audi. Despite the performance disparity, both crossovers maintain an identical 21 MPG combined rating. The SQ5 Sportback has a lower MSRP at $61,800 versus the Aviator's $59,295, although the Lincoln provides greater dimensions (199.7 inches long vs. 184.6 inches for the Audi). For utility, the Audi offers superior maximum cargo space at 24.7 cu ft, while the larger Aviator only manages 19.2 cu ft. The SQ5 uses AWD, while the Aviator is RWD, providing different foundational driving dynamics.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about comparing the 2025 Audi SQ5 Sportback and 2025 Lincoln Aviator.

Which vehicle provides better fuel economy for daily driving?

Both vehicles share an identical 21 MPG combined rating, though the Lincoln Aviator achieves slightly better highway efficiency at 25 MPG compared to the Audi SQ5 Sportback's 24 MPG highway.

Why does the Lincoln Aviator have lower cargo capacity despite being larger overall?

The Audi SQ5 Sportback provides 24.7 cu ft of cargo space compared to the Aviator's 19.2 cu ft. This difference often relates to the roofline execution on these specific body styles, even if the Aviator is longer and taller.

Is the Audi SQ5 Sportback's standard AWD better than the Aviator's RWD setup?

The Audi's standard AWD offers consistent traction distribution, generally preferred in variable conditions, whereas the Lincoln's base RWD layout prioritizes longitudinal dynamics but may require opting for an AWD package.

How significant is the difference in engine performance between the two?

The difference is substantial; the Lincoln Aviator's 400 hp and 415 lb-ft of torque significantly surpass the Audi SQ5 Sportback's 349 hp and 369 lb-ft of torque.

Are both vehicles mandated to use premium fuel?

Yes, both the 2025 Audi SQ5 Sportback and the 2025 Lincoln Aviator recommend premium unleaded fuel for optimal operation based on their respective turbocharged engines.

Which vehicle has a lower barrier to entry based on MSRP?

The 2025 Lincoln Aviator starts at $59,295, making it the more affordable option compared to the 2025 Audi SQ5 Sportback, which has an MSRP of $61,800.
